[newlib-cygwin] Use high-resolution timebases for select().


https://sourceware.org/git/gitweb.cgi?p=newlib-cygwin.git;h=a23e6a35d896a075640db714b28ce74bb6b8d7ff

commit a23e6a35d896a075640db714b28ce74bb6b8d7ff
Author: John Hood <cgull@glup.org>
Date:   Wed May 18 19:14:16 2016 -0400

    Use high-resolution timebases for select().
    
    * select.h: Change prototype for select_stuff::wait() for larger
      microsecond timeouts.
    * select.cc (pselect): Convert from old cygwin_select().
      Implement microsecond timeouts.
      (cygwin_select): Rewrite as a wrapper on pselect().
      (select): Implement microsecond timeouts.
      (select_stuff::wait): Implement microsecond timeouts with a timer
      object.
